wiki:Reunion190717

Acta de la videoconferencia del 19 de julio de 2017

Asisten: Teruel, Málaga, Zaragoza y Sevilla
Próxima reunión: septiembre de 2017

Leyendas:

  • Icono tareas pendientes. Tareas pendientes.
  • Icono mejoras. Mejoras.

Actualización del la web del proyecto

Se ha migrado a una máquina virtual nueva con Ubuntu 16.04.

Se ha actualizado el trac a la versión 1.2, se sigue "afinando" la configuración.

  • Va más lenta la página de eventos, y otras con muchas consultas a la BD.
  • La zona de descargas y el subversión van más rápidos.
  • Mejoras de seguridad:
    • Filtra los usuarios sospechosos, diariamente hay uno 500 intentos rechazados.
    • Se utiliza https con un certificado de Let's encrypt.

Durante el cambio ha habido problemas temporales para instalar y actualizar, ya que el cambio afectaba al svn y a la zona de descargas.

En el wiki cuando se hayan utilizado enlaces absolutos estarán mal, ya que al ponerle el certificado ha habido que pasar la url de la página al subdirectorio opengnsys.es/trac.

Al cambiar de versión el formato para mostrar el listado de contenido en las páginas cambia, de

[[TOC(heading=Índice)]] 

para a ser

[[PageOutline(2-5,Índice)]]

Últimos cambios

Lista de compatibilidad

En la lista de compatibilidad se incluyen los sistemas operativos y los sistemas de ficheros permitidos para el servidor y el cliente.

  • Se recomienda instalar en Ubuntu 16.04.
  • Se prueba a instalar en Centos 7 y va bien, pero no se prueba el uso de los comandos.

Gestor de arranque gráfico

Se están realizando pruebas con:

  • Burg: Para particiones MBR. Proyecto no mantenido pero que funciona en bastante hardware.
  • rEFInd: Para sistemas UEFI y EFI. Proyecto que sigue en desarrollo.

#679 Varios repositorios para un mismo cliente

ogChangeRepo es la función que nos permite cambiar el repositorio de un cliente OpenGnsys de forma dinámica.

Acepta como parámetros la ip del repositorio y opcionalmente el directorio de la unidad organizativa. Si el parámetro del repositorio es la cadena 'REPO' mantiene el repositorio actual, antes cambiaba al repositorio por defecto.

#770 Imágenes sincronizadas: transferencia multicast

La consola permite eliminar imágenes sincronizadas tipo archivo v1.1 del repositorio, antes no las detectaba.

La restauración de sincronizadas se adaptan a varios repositorios.

  • La consola al restaurar las sincronizadas muestra las imágenes de todos los repositorios de la OU, antes sólo mostraba las imágenes de los repositorios asociados a los equipos del ámbito.
  • Los script permiten como parámetro repo REPO|CACHE|IP-REPO, si es REPO mantiene el repositorio que tenga montado y si es una ip compara con el repositorio actual y si no coincide lo cambia.

La restauración de sincronizadas se adaptan a unidades organizativas con subdirectorios separados:

  • Las funciones relacionadas con rsync o multicast envían al servidor el dato de la imagen incluyendo el directorio de la unidad organizativa.

Se usan los parámetros y protocolos como en deployImage: se permite MULTICAST-DIRECT, MULTICAST-CACHE, RSYNC_DIRECT y RSYNC-CACHE.

#801 opengnsys_update.sh con url de descarga incorrecto

Durante el cambio en la versión del trac ha habido errores al instalar y al actualizar.

Se han realizado los cambios necesarios en el web de OpenGnsys, realizando las redirecciones necesarias para adaptarse a las nuevas URLs (no se requieren cambios en el código de OpenGnsys 1.0.x).

Asimismo, para OpenGnsys 1.1.0 se han retocado los scripts, adaptándolos a las nuevas URLs.

Se cierra el ticket.

Asistente de particionado

Si en un equipo particionado con la versión 1.0.5 de OpenGnsys se realiza un cambio en alguna partición con la versión 1.0.6b se pierden todos los datos del disco.

Se debe al cambio realizado en el asistente de particionado para los discos con sector de 4096k, en estos discos al particionar con la 1.0.6b se cambia el inicio de la tabla de particiones por lo que al modificar cualquier partición se modifican todas perdiendo el contenido.

Es muy importante. Se mandará un correo a la lista y se pondrá un mensaje en el asistente Icono tareas pendientes..

Documentación de las pruebas de la 1.1.0

En Google Drive se ha creado una carpeta pruebav1.1 y dos documentos:

  • Banco de pruebas por operación.
  • Banco de pruebas por ticket.

En el wiki ya existían estás páginas, se ha incluido en ellas un mensaje informativo con el enlace a los documentos de Google Drive que advierte que no se incluya información en el wiki.

Si se utilizan los enlaces los documentos están disponibles con permisos de lectura o escritura según los permisos que tenga la cuenta de usuario de Google.

Ticket abiertos

#786 Adaptar el ogLive-precise-3.2.0-23-generic-r4820.iso como ogLive de 32 bits

Falla al bajarse de la zona de descargas.

Se generará de nuevo mañana. Si da tiempo se incluirá la funcionalidad de varias unidades organizativas y varios repositorios.Icono tareas pendientes.

#796 burg como systemMenu gráfico

Las funcionalidades básicas ya están terminadas.

  • El comando para instalarlo está incluido en el ogLive.
  • Se han creado funcionas análogas a las de grub para utilizarlas en la postconfiguración.

Se cerrará el ticket.

#789 Actualizar plantilla PXE al mover ordenador

Está terminado, falta cerrarlo.

#792 incluir en los html personalizados de ejemplo los enlaces al acceso privado.

Está realizada la parte del menú público con el enlace al menú privado.

Falta el ejemplo del menú privado Icono tareas pendientes..

#793 unificar los recursos en red del ogLive [shared]

Se pasa a la versión 1.1.1.

#797 revisar log en los procesos de restauración

La comparación de los log de la versión 1.0.6 y la versión 1.1 está en la página del ticket Icono tareas pendientes..

#799 consola web: estado de los equipos tarda en mostrarse

Lo único que podría mejorarlo es poner un tiempo de timeout menor para la espera del servidor a la respuesta del estado de los equipos.

#738 Consola Web. Se pierde nombre de la imagen restaurada

Actualizar configuración del cliente tras restaurar imagen básica.

Em el cliente de OpenGnsys (ogAdmClient) se ha modificado el comando de restauración de la imagen para que al finalizar actualice la información del sistema de ficheros del cliente y luego guarde los datos de la imagen restaurada.

Anteriormente sólo se guardaban los datos y en el siguiente reinicio si cambiaba el sistema de fichero se eliminaba el nombre de la imagen.

Equipos iMAC

En Sevilla se ha estado probando en la Facultad de Bellas Artes. Se crea y se restaura bien la imagen pero en el momento que se hace un chequeo del aistema de ficheros de la partición, ya sea desde OpenGnsys o desde MacOs, se corrompe y no arranca más.

En la UPC en la escuela de Informática tienen bastante experiencia con los equipos MAC, se les podría consultar además de a Málaga.

Los equipos iMAC no soportan PXE, por lo que se les instala un grub que arranca el sistema operativo o arranca OpenGnsys. El script de instalación del grub guarda los archivos necesarios en dos sitios, la partición EFI y la partición de Sistema. Esto último se debe a que algunos versiones de MacOs no tienen la partición EFI.

La información del wiki sobre este tema es bastante antigua habría que revisarla y enlazarla con el manual de usuarios en la parte de usuarios avanzados Icono tareas pendientes..

Ya hay varias universidades utilizando equipos iMac, sería bueno documentar como se realizan los distintos procedimientos (preparación equipo modelo, creación imagen,...) para compararlos y compartir conocimientos.

Last modified 2 years ago Last modified on Jul 25, 2017, 11:21:38 AM